A Meissen figure of Columbine
Circa 1748, blue crossed swords mark to back of base
Modelled by J.J. Kndler, wearing a puce turquoise-lined hat, white bodice, white apron, puce flowered skirt and pale-yellow shoes, playing the hurdy-gurdy, seated on rockwork applied with coloured flowers and foliage (left fingers restored replacements, chipping to foliage and apron, slight chipping to brim of hat, hurdy-gurdy and ribbons, minute chipping to extremities at back)
5 in. (13.3 cm.) high
